أحمد حايس
الرئيسيةمن أناالدوراتالمدونةالمناهج والباقات
أحمد حايس

دورات عربية متخصصة في التقنية والبرمجة والذكاء الاصطناعي.

المنصة مبنية على الوضوح، التطبيق، والنتيجة النافعة: شرح مرتب يساعدك تفهم الأدوات، تكتب كودًا أفضل، وتستخدم الذكاء الاصطناعي بوعي داخل العمل الحقيقي.

تعلم أسرعوصول مباشر للدورات والمسارات من الموبايل.
تنقل أوضحالروابط الأساسية والدعم في مكان واحد بدون تشتيت.

المنصة

  • الرئيسية
  • من أنا
  • الدورات
  • المناهج والباقات
  • المدونة

الدعم

  • الأسئلة الشائعة
  • تواصل معنا
  • سياسة الخصوصية
  • شروط استخدام التطبيق
  • سياسة الاسترجاع
محتاج مسار سريع؟
ابدأ من الدوراتتواصل معناالأسئلة الشائعة

© 2026 أحمد حايس. جميع الحقوق محفوظة.

الرئيسيةالدوراتالمناهجالمدونةالدخول

المدونة

مقالات عملية مرتبة حسب المجال والمستوى، اختر المجال المناسب واقرأ من مستوى مبتدئ إلى محترف.

المجال
كل المجالات
تكنولوجياDevOps بالعربيHow To Make ItOptimizing بالعربيأحدث أخبار التكنولوجياالأوتوميشنالبرمجة بالعربيالذكاء الاصطناعي
المستوى
كل المستوياتمبتدئمتوسطمحترف
Reranking للمحترف: ليه RAG بترجع نتيجة غلط رغم Embeddings ممتازة
محترف٨ مايو ٢٠٢٦

Reranking للمحترف: ليه RAG بترجع نتيجة غلط رغم Embeddings ممتازة

لو الـ RAG بتاعك Recall@10 عنده 92% بس الإجابة الأولى غلط نص الوقت، المشكلة مش في الـ Embeddings. المشكلة إنك بتعتمد على bi-encoder لوحده وفايتك خط دفاع تاني اسمه Cross-encoder Reranking. مقال للمحترف بمثال لجنة التحكيم للمبتدئ، تعريف علمي للـ cross-attention، كود BGE-reranker شغّال، أرقام مقاسة من BEIR (NDCG@10 من 0.61 لـ 0.78)، 4 trade-offs، ومتى الـ reranker بيضرّك مش بينفعك.

6 دقائق قراءة
Tail Latency للمحترف: ليه P99 يكسر 5% من مستخدميك
محترف٨ مايو ٢٠٢٦

Tail Latency للمحترف: ليه P99 يكسر 5% من مستخدميك

المتوسط بيخبّي الكارثة. لو الـ API بيرد في 80ms متوسط لكن P99 = 2400ms، فيه شريحة كاملة من مستخدميك بتعيش تجربة مكسورة. مقال للمحترف بمثال خط الإنتاج للمبتدئ، تعريف علمي للنسب المئوية من ورقة Dean و Barroso "The Tail at Scale"، كود k6 شغّال يقيس P50/P95/P99، أرقام مقاسة من service بـ 5000 RPS، 3 أسباب شائعة لارتفاع الذيل، trade-offs الـ hedged requests، ومتى لا تركّز على P99 أصلاً.

6 دقائق قراءة
PostgreSQL Partitioning: حوّل query من 8 ثواني لـ 118ms بـ 4 سطور SQL
محترف٨ مايو ٢٠٢٦

PostgreSQL Partitioning: حوّل query من 8 ثواني لـ 118ms بـ 4 سطور SQL

لو جدول events عندك بقى 218 مليون صف وquery على آخر 7 أيام بياخد 8 ثواني، Declarative Partitioning في PostgreSQL 16 بيخلي planner يقفز للـ partition المطلوب فقط فالاستعلام ينزل لـ 118ms. شرح للمستوى المحترف بمثال مكتبة المخازن، تعريف علمي دقيق، استراتيجيات RANGE وLIST وHASH، كود SQL شغّال، أرقام مقاسة، trade-offs، وحالات لا تستخدم فيها.

6 دقائق قراءة
LLM-as-a-Judge للمحترف: قيّم 10,000 إجابة AI بـ $30 بدل $5,000
محترف٨ مايو ٢٠٢٦

LLM-as-a-Judge للمحترف: قيّم 10,000 إجابة AI بـ $30 بدل $5,000

لو فريق الـ QA بيراجع 200 إجابة LLM في الأسبوع وعندك 10,000 إجابة يومياً، الـ coverage بتاعك 1.4% وأنت في الإنتاج بدون شبكة أمان. LLM-as-a-Judge بيقيّم العشرة آلاف كاملة في 3 ساعات بـ $30 والاتفاق مع المراجع البشري بيوصل 83%. مقال للمحترف بمثال مدرّس الإنشاء للمبتدئ، التعريف العلمي من ورقة Zheng et al. (NeurIPS 2023)، كود Python شغّال على Anthropic SDK مع pairwise مقاوم للـ position bias، أرقام مقاسة من 12,400 تذكرة دعم عربية، 4 trade-offs حقيقية، وحالات لا تستخدم فيها التقنية أصلاً.

7 دقائق قراءة
Prompt Caching للمحترف في Claude: ازاي تقطع تكلفة الـ Input 90% وتسرّع الرد 4x
محترف٨ مايو ٢٠٢٦

Prompt Caching للمحترف في Claude: ازاي تقطع تكلفة الـ Input 90% وتسرّع الرد 4x

لو الـ agent بتاعك بيرسل system prompt حجمه 35 KB في كل طلب، الموديل بيقراه من الصفر وبتدفع كامل التوكنز. Prompt Caching بيحفظ الجزء الثابت على سيرفر Anthropic ويعيد استخدامه بسعر 10% وزمن TTFT أقل بـ 4x. مقال للمحترف بمثال الكاشير للمبتدئ، تعريف علمي للـ KV cache، كود Python شغّال على Anthropic SDK، أرقام مقاسة من إنتاج (88% انخفاض الفاتورة)، trade-offs الـ cache invalidation، وحالات لا يستحق فيها التفعيل.

7 دقائق قراءة
KV Cache و PagedAttention للمحترف: ليه vLLM بيخدم 8x طلبات أكتر
محترف٨ مايو ٢٠٢٦

KV Cache و PagedAttention للمحترف: ليه vLLM بيخدم 8x طلبات أكتر

لو شغّلت Llama 3 70B على A100 80GB ولقيت السيرفر بيرفض الطلب رقم 16، الموديل مش هو اللي بياكل الذاكرة. KV Cache هو، وبيهدر 60-80% منها في تجزئة. PagedAttention في vLLM بترفع الإنتاجية 8x. مقال للمحترف بشرح علمي دقيق، كود vLLM 0.7+ شغّال، أرقام من ورقة Kwon et al. SOSP 2023.

6 دقائق قراءة
Prompt Caching في Claude للمحترف: وفّر 90% من تكلفة الـ API و 6x من زمن الاستجابة
محترف٨ مايو ٢٠٢٦

Prompt Caching في Claude للمحترف: وفّر 90% من تكلفة الـ API و 6x من زمن الاستجابة

لو تطبيقك بيبعت نفس الـ system prompt الطويل مع كل request، أنت بتدفع 100% كل مرة بلا داعي. Prompt Caching بيقطع التكلفة لـ 10% والـ time-to-first-token من 2.1 ثانية لـ 0.32. مقال للمحترف بمثال الكاشير للمبتدئ، تعريف علمي للـ KV Cache Persistence، كود Python شغّال على Anthropic SDK، أرقام مقاسة من إنتاج 18,000 طلب يومي، 4 trade-offs حقيقية، وحالات لا تستخدمه فيها أصلاً.

6 دقائق قراءة
KEDA للمحترف: scale Kafka Consumers من Lag بدل CPU
محترف٨ مايو ٢٠٢٦

KEDA للمحترف: scale Kafka Consumers من Lag بدل CPU

لو 8 microservices بتاكل 24 pod طول اليوم وفيهم 3 بس اللي عنده شغل وقت الذروة، بتدفع لـ idle بنسبة 60%+. KEDA بيربط عدد الـ pods بـ Kafka consumer lag مباشرةً، فبتدفع للشغل الحقيقي بس. شرح للمحترف بمثال العيادة للمبتدئ، تعريف علمي للـ ScaledObject، YAML شغّال على KEDA 2.13، أرقام إنتاج (70% توفير، 3x تحسّن في P99)، trade-offs الـ cold start و rebalance، ومتى لا تستخدم scale-to-zero أصلاً.

6 دقائق قراءة
GIL في Python للمحترف: ليه threading مش بيسرّع كودك حتى مع 16 core
محترف٨ مايو ٢٠٢٦

GIL في Python للمحترف: ليه threading مش بيسرّع كودك حتى مع 16 core

لو شغّلت 8 threads في Python على CPU بـ 16 core وفوجئت إن الكود ماتسرّعش بل بطئ، السبب اسمه Global Interpreter Lock. مقال للمحترف بمثال الميكروفون الواحد للمبتدئ، تعريف علمي دقيق لـ CPython وbytecode evaluation، كود Python 3.12 شغّال يقيس الفرق بين threading و multiprocessing، أرقام مقاسة فعلياً، نظرة على PEP 703 وفكرة free-threaded Python، trade-offs واضحة، وحالات يبقى فيها threading منطقي رغم الـ GIL.

6 دقائق قراءة

عرض 82 - 90 من 108 مقال

السابق
1
…9
10
11
12
التالي